Introduction to Batch Management Software and Its Market Analysis


Batch Management Software oversees and controls production processes involving batches of products. It enhances efficiency, ensures compliance, and streamlines operations in industries like pharmaceuticals, food, and chemicals.

Advantages include improved traceability, reduced waste, optimized resource utilization, and real-time data visibility, leading to better decision-making. Additionally, it integrates seamlessly with other systems, enhancing overall operational agility.

In terms of Product Type, the Batch Management Software market is segmented into:


  • Software
  • Service


Batch management software can be categorized into two main types: software solutions and service-based platforms. Software solutions typically offer comprehensive tools for managing batch processes within a production environment, providing functionalities like recipe management, production scheduling, and quality control. On the other hand, service-based platforms, often cloud-based, provide flexibility and scalability, allowing companies to access batch management capabilities without extensive on-premise infrastructure. In the current market, software solutions dominate the market share significantly due to their robust features and the ability to integrate with existing enterprise systems, catering to a wide range of industry needs for efficient batch processing.

The competitive landscape of the Batch Management Software market features several key players, each employing innovative strategies to navigate an evolving technological landscape.

Siemens, a frontrunner in automation and digitalization, emphasizes IoT and cloud computing for enhanced data analytics, ensuring greater operational efficiency. The company has consistently reported strong financial performance, leveraging its Industrial Edge solutions to expand market share.

Rockwell Automation focuses on smart manufacturing, utilizing its FactoryTalk software and collaborating with partners to integrate AI and machine learning into batch processes. This strategy has seen significant adoption, particularly in pharmaceuticals and food and beverage sectors.

ABB leverages its digital capabilities to provide scalable batch management solutions as part of its Digitalisation strategy. The company has a strong track record in delivering reliable solutions while capitalizing on the transition toward sustainable manufacturing practices.

Honeywell’s Process Solutions unit emphasizes safety and reliability, integrating advanced automation and data analytics into its batch management offerings. The company’s focus on cybersecurity along with cloud solutions has steadily increased its market presence.

Emerson Electric is innovating through its DeltaV batch management system, targeting industries that require complex batch processes. The introduction of digital twin technology has added to its competitive edge.
